4 ounces whole wheat penne |
1/4 cup olive oil (mufa) |
1 cup grape tomatoes, halved (12-15) |
5 garlic cloves, pressed |
1/2 cup white wine |
3/4 lb salmon fillet, wild, cut into bite-size pieces, boneless, skinless |
4 tablespoons fresh sweet basil leaves, chopped (to taste) |
2 tablespoons fresh oregano, chopped |
1 tablespoon capers, rinsed and drained (optional) |
Directions:
1. 1. PREPARE pasta per package directions. 2. 2. HEAT oil in large skillet over medium-high heat while pasta cooks. Add tomatoes and cook 1 to 2 minutes. Raise heat to high and add wine, salmon, basil, oregano, garlic and capers and cook until salmon is just opaque, about 4 minutes. Or cook other ingredients and add grilled salmon with pasta in step 3. 3. 3. DRAIN pasta and add to skillet. Toss with tomatoes and salmon to combine. Divide equally among 4 bowls. Sprinkle with additional basil and oregano, if desired. 4. Nutritional Info Per Serving. 5. 385 cal, 21 g pro, 25 g carb, 3 g fiber, 20 g fat, 2.5 g sat fat, 47 mg chol, 111 mg sodium. |
